I wonder whether the {latlh law' cham Sarmey} for "many additional varieties of technology" is correct; can we place the {law'} on the {latlh} ?
Always prefer to put the adjectival verb at the end of the entire
noun phrase, unless you can't escape doing otherwise. latlh
cham Sar law' many additional technology varieties.
This is not a grammatical rule, but it will generally solve this
problem you keep having.
